Job Description

Responsible for developing localizing, updating, and delivering the fire training programs while assisting chief Fire Instructor in carrying out the required firefighting emergency response training.

  • Develop, update and localize fire Training Programs to International applicable certification standards.
  • Ensure trainees competency levels are met
  • Ensuring compliance with health & safety policies & Procedures.
  • Deliver fire training programs to certify trainees to NFPA and other international standards.
  • Develop and manage Fire Training policies and procedures.
  • Advise on fire aspects to ensure all emergency response personnel are competent through well managed training programmes.
  • Develop & implement the standing instruction relative to the operation and maintenance of the relevant training equipment assigned to the fire program.
  • Ensure that fire training equipment is available for use and in the state of readiness for the college training programs
  • Evaluate the effectiveness of the fire programs through participant feedback & test instruments.
  • Review current training programmes for Currency and technical accuracy to provide reports to the line management.
  • Conduct Risk Assessments, inspections, safety observations.
  • Supervise & control the fire training center personnel, equipment, facilities, and activities.
  • Ensure fire training and development programmes are conducted safely and competently.
  • Monitor and assist in achieving the fire training objectives and KPIs to improve performance.
  • Coordinates and tracks certification & re-certification of staff as required.
  • Responsible for administrative work in planning, organizing, coordinating, and directing the fire training activities of the Fire Training Centre.
  • Responsible for ensuring work instructions/manuals / SOPs / Management systems / Department procedures are reviewed as per the management review schedule system.
  • Responsible for ensuring all firefighting equipment’s inspection programs are maintained and certifications are documented.

Qualifications & Experience:

  • Bachelor’s Degree
  • Minimum Fire Fighter 2 and Fire Instructor 1 certified; Fire Inspector 2 preferred
  • Advanced spoken and written English
  • Completed Basic Fire Fighter & Breathing Apparatus Wearer Course
  • 8 years of experience: 6 years in firefighting (preferably in Oil, Gas, and petrochemical industries) and 4 years as an inspector at a centralized fire and emergency training center
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office and database management
  • Experience as a firefighter in both career and volunteer roles.
